2009 Audi A4 vs. 1975 Lancia Stratos
To start off, 2009 Audi A4 is newer by 34 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1975 Lancia Stratos.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1975 Lancia Stratos would be higher. At 2,418 cc (6 cylinders), 1975 Lancia Stratos is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Audi A4 (218 HP @ 5900 RPM) has 31 more horse power than 1975 Lancia Stratos. (187 HP @ 7000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Audi A4 should accelerate faster than 1975 Lancia Stratos.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Audi A4 weights approximately 615 kg more than 1975 Lancia Stratos.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2009 Audi A4 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1975 Lancia Stratos.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Audi A4 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Audi A4 (300 Nm @ 2200 RPM) has 75 more torque (in Nm) than 1975 Lancia Stratos. (225 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2009 Audi A4 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1975 Lancia Stratos.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Audi A4 | 1975 Lancia Stratos | |
Make | Audi | Lancia |
Model | A4 | Stratos |
Year Released | 2009 | 1975 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 1984 cc | 2418 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 218 HP | 187 HP |
Engine RPM | 5900 RPM | 7000 RPM |
Torque | 300 Nm | 225 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2200 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82.5 mm | 92.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92.8 mm | 60 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 9.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 244 km/hour | 230 km/hour |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1595 kg | 980 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4610 mm | 3710 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1120 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2190 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9 L/100km | 10.1 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 63 L | 80 L |
